Output cd791005c2ea555048c187524d64d9e582ab2f74b98a48bed9f256ebe13e78b4:48

value
32627671
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 faf72fdd2da69b0034bcd236a2621c84273a9665 OP_EQUALVERIFY OP_CHECKSIG
address
1Psz3owRq23pQYTWyEopHsvRpHLLcBVVxD
transaction
cd791005c2ea555048c187524d64d9e582ab2f74b98a48bed9f256ebe13e78b4
confirmations
290051
spent
true